以文本方式查看主题 - Foxtable(狐表) (http://foxtable.net/bbs/index.asp) -- 专家坐堂 (http://foxtable.net/bbs/list.asp?boardid=2) ---- 如何判断在“文本框”为空的情况 (http://foxtable.net/bbs/dispbbs.asp?boardid=2&id=93219) |
-- 作者:njl2016k9 -- 发布时间:2016/11/23 9:55:00 -- 如何判断在“文本框”为空的情况 请问: 如何判断在“文本框”为空的情况下,(也就是没有输入任何内容的情况下)不做任何事。 Dim rq As WinForm.TextBox = e.Form.Controls("日期") If rq.Text=" " t
Then Nothing Else Tables("订单").AddNew Dim i As Integer = Tables("订单").Rows.Count Tables("订单").Rows(i-1)("日期")=rq.Text End If 是这样写吗? |
-- 作者:有点蓝 -- 发布时间:2016/11/23 10:08:00 -- Dim rq As WinForm.TextBox = e.Form.Controls("日期") If rq.Text > "" Then Dim dr As Row = Tables("订单").AddNew dr("日期")=rq.Text End If 另外日期型数据最好使用日期控件,不要使用文本框 Dim rq As WinForm.DateTimePicker = e.Form.Controls("日期") If rq.Value IsNot Nothing Then Dim dr As Row = Tables("订单").AddNew dr("日期")=rq.Value End If |
-- 作者:njl2016k9 -- 发布时间:2016/11/23 10:46:00 -- 感谢! |